        Sloughis are smart, too. Barud and Beldi regularly got a small treat during the walk. Barud

        could still sometimes insist that he wanted another treat, which was not always
        successful. Then he walked ahead of me, stepped into the plowed field (he knew that was
        not allowed, because then I would have lost sight of them in no time). I did not have time
        to tell him to stay on 'this side', because at the word 'this' he was already standing next to
        me with a head like: “Now I am a very good boy and I deserve a cookie.” .... Well, that was
        true. He then continued walking with complete satisfaction, so funny!

        What is the nicest thing about the breed? Are there any disadvantages to the breed?

        Sloughis are special dogs, you have to be able to deal with their character. They are also
        often very subtle in their expression. They are not panting, wagging their tails loudly or
        jumping madly. They can do all that but it seems beneath their dignity.


        The only real disadvantage I find are those short stick hairs that really get into everything.
        But other than that I can't think of any disadvantages. They are great housemates and

        travel companions. If you let them get used to many things as a young dog you will enjoy
        it a lot later on. They like to go out with their owner but also like to lie on the couch next
        to you, nice and warm.
